About Carlos Muñoz

Carlos Muñoz is a scholar working on Critical Care and Intensive Care Medicine, Cell Biology and Orthodontics, having authored 45 papers that have together received 2.7k indexed citations. Recurring topics across this work include Hemoglobin structure and function (21 papers), Erythrocyte Function and Pathophysiology (6 papers) and Heme Oxygenase-1 and Carbon Monoxide (6 papers). The work is most often cited by research in Critical Care and Intensive Care Medicine (643 citations), Emergency Medicine (1.0k citations) and Pulmonary and Respiratory Medicine (2.1k citations). Carlos Muñoz has collaborated with scholars based in United States, Germany and Chile. Frequent co-authors include Carmen Sílvia Valente Barbas, Carlos Roberto Ribeiro de Carvalho, Geraldo Lorenzi‐Filho, Denise Machado Medeiros, Guilherme Paula Pinto Schettino, Marcelo B. P. Amato, Roselaine Pinheiro de Oliveira, Ronaldo Adib Kairalla, Daniel Deheinzelin and R Magaldi. Their work appears in journals such as New England Journal of Medicine, Blood and Journal of Applied Physiology.
